Pure and Refined Corn Oil
Corn oil is a nutritious and flexible cooking oil extracted from corn kernels. It's popular for its neutral flavor, making it ideal for a range of culinary applications.
Refined corn oil undergoes a comprehensive process to remove impurities and create a bright liquid with a high smoke point. This makes it perfect for baking, as well as salad dressings and marinades.
Corn oil is a provider of essential fatty acids, including healthy fats, which support overall health.

Master Al Dente Perfection: Enjoy Your Spaghetti Pasta Fresh
There's nothing quite like a perfectly cooked plate of spaghetti. When the pasta is cooked just right, it's firm with a slight bite, absorbing your sauce beautifully. To attain this coveted al dente texture, it's all about understanding the timing and giving your pasta the attention it deserves.
- Don't overcook your pasta! Constantly stir it while it cooks to prevent sticking.
- Keep in mind that cooking times can vary depending on the shape and thickness of your spaghetti.
- Try your pasta a minute or two before the recommended cooking time to ensure it's reached that perfect al dente stage.
With these simple tips, you can always produce mouthwatering spaghetti that will have your family and friends asking for more!
